EDTE 491 - Seminar in Techn & Engring Ed

Institution:
Millersville University of Pennsylvania
Subject:
Technology Education
Description:
A seminar dealing with professional education issues and effective teaching and learning during the technology and engineering education student teaching experience. Emphasis on planning, teaching, managing, and assessing technology and engineering education units of instruction. Attention given to legal issues, safety, professional development, and meeting the needs of all learners in the technology and engineering education environment, including English language learners and students with disabilities.
